rb_producer and rb_comsumer, kernel thread uses lot of CPU (~100%)
bandwidth every 10s.

bisection results commit:
[5092dbc96f3acdac5433b27c06860352dc6d23b9] ring-buffer: add benchmark and tester
I have read commit logs:
git log -r 5092dbc96f3acdac5433b27c06860352dc6d23b9

Is it correct behavior for these thread to consume this much cpu
bandwidth even if someone selects rb benchmarks config options?
